Key developments
Apple's Four Smart-Glass Designs
Apple is reportedly testing four different smart-glass designs using premium materials, according to multiple industry sources. The company is exploring multiple form factors to determine which design best balances aesthetics, comfort, and functionality for everyday wear. Apple's approach reportedly emphasizes premium materials and seamless integration with the company's ecosystem of devices and services.
The timeline for Apple's smart glasses appears to be accelerating: a public reveal is expected by the end of 2026, with consumer availability targeted for 2027. This represents a significant push from Apple into the augmented reality market, building on years of development in ARKit and the Vision Pro headset.
Meta's Price Cut Strategy
Meta has responded to increasing competition by cutting the price of Ray-Ban prescription smart glasses to $499, significantly lowering the barrier to entry for consumers. The move positions Meta's smart glasses as an affordable alternative to higher-priced competitors while maintaining the brand appeal of the Ray-Ban partnership.
Meta's strategy centers on capturing early market share before Apple's entry, demonstrating the company's recognition that first-mover advantage in wearable AI could prove decisive in establishing platform standards and developer ecosystems.
Technical Challenges Remain
Both companies face significant technical hurdles in achieving all-day wearability. Key challenges include display brightness for outdoor use, battery life optimization, and heat dissipation during extended wear. These technical constraints have limited previous attempts at consumer smart glasses, but advances in micro-display technology and efficient processors are finally making commercially viable designs feasible.
What to watch
Apple's Ecosystem Advantage
Apple's custom silicon and deep ecosystem integration could provide meaningful differentiation once the product launches. The company's ability to seamlessly connect smart glasses with iPhone, Mac, and Apple Watch could create a compelling user experience that competitors struggle to match. However, Apple's historical premium pricing may limit initial adoption compared to Meta's more aggressive positioning.
Meta's Market Position
Meta's early entry and aggressive pricing strategy aim to establish smart glasses as a mainstream category before Apple arrives. The company's partnership with EssilorLuxottica (Ray-Ban) provides established retail distribution and brand credibility. Meta's success in building developer interest for its smart glasses platform will be critical to creating the app ecosystem needed for sustained growth.
Competitive Landscape
The smart glasses race also includes other players: Google continues development of Android-powered smart glasses, while Snap maintains its Spectacles line focused on younger demographics. The entry of Apple and Meta's intensification suggest that 2026-2027 will be a defining period for wearable AI adoption.
